python读取excel数据在list
时间: 2024-11-24 11:04:12 浏览: 18
python如何读取excel表数据.rar
在Python中,可以使用pandas库方便地读取Excel文件并将数据存储到列表或其他数据结构中。pandas提供了一个`read_excel`函数,用于从Excel文件加载数据。以下是基本步骤:
1. 首先,需要安装pandas和openpyxl或xlrd库,分别用于处理.xlsx和.xls格式的文件。你可以通过pip安装它们:
```bash
pip install pandas openpyxl # 或者如果你处理旧版本的xls文件,用pip install xlrd
```
2. 使用pandas读取Excel文件并选择需要的列:
```python
import pandas as pd
# 加载数据
df = pd.read_excel('your_file.xlsx')
# 如果你想将某一行或某一列的数据转换成列表,可以这样做:
# 如果是单列:
column_list = df['column_name'].tolist()
# 如果是多行数据(例如第一行):
data_rows = df.iloc[0].tolist()
```
这里,`your_file.xlsx`替换为你的Excel文件路径,`column_name`是你要提取的具体列名。
3. 如果你需要整个DataFrame的所有行作为列表,可以直接使用`values`属性:
```python
all_data_rows = df.values.tolist()
```
阅读全文